is it normal??

So I'm 33 weeks and my doctor has only checked my cervix once at 12 weeks..how often is the doctor suppose to check because I want to know if I have dialated any? My doctor always seems to be in a rush..every appt all she checks is the heart beat and blood work..is this normal?

33wks isn't full term yet so unless you are showing symptoms of preterm labor there is no reason to check your cervix this early

With my first I'm pretty sure my midwife didn't check my cervix til I was 39 weeks or later - I appreciated that since it's not too comfortable to get checked all the time.  I wouldn't be worried - It is pretty unlikely you would be dialated this early and if so nothing more than 1cm which isn't anything exciting.  Maybe the dr. being in a rush every apt makes you nervous and feel uncared for but the fact that she doesn't check your cervix is no big deal.  I'm 30.5 weeks and never been checked once for this baby.
